The first rule of paintball clothing is to cover up as much as possible. This means wearing long sleeves, long pants, and closed-toe shoes. You’ll also want to wear layers that can be removed or added as needed. As you’ll be running, crouching, and diving, you’ll want clothing that’s both comfortable and flexible. Breathable fabric is also important, especially if you’re playing in warm weather.
When it comes to footwear, choose shoes that provide good traction and ankle support. Paintball fields can be slippery, and you’ll be running around a lot, so you’ll want shoes that are both comfortable and secure. Avoid sandals or open-toed shoes, as they don’t provide adequate protection for your feet.
One of the most important pieces of gear you’ll need for paintball is a protective mask. The mask should fit snugly around your face and have a high-impact lens that can withstand paintball hits. Make sure that the mask has a full seal around your eyes, nose, and mouth, and that it doesn’t obstruct your vision. Most paintball fields will have masks available for rent, but you can also purchase your own.
In addition to a mask, you may want to wear other protective gear, such as a chest protector, gloves, and knee pads. While not essential, these items can help reduce the impact of paintball hits and prevent bruises or scrapes. Chest protectors are particularly useful for women, as they can help protect against hits to the chest area.
Finally, it’s important to choose clothing that’s appropriate for the environment in which you’ll be playing. If you’re playing in a wooded area, choose clothing that’s dark or camouflaged to help you blend in with your surroundings. If you’re playing on a brightly-colored field, choose clothing that won’t clash with the colors of the field.
